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3

Grado obtenido: Especialista en sistemas embebidos

Detalles Bibliográficos
Autor principal: Puga, Gerardo L.
Otros Autores: Ridolfi, Pablo
Formato: Tesis de maestría acceptedVersion
Lenguaje:Español
Publicado: Universidad de Buenos Aires. Facultad de Ingeniería 2016
Materias:
Acceso en línea:https://bibliotecadigital.fi.uba.ar/items/show/18432
https://bibliotecadigital.fi.uba.ar/files/original/fbd9b01e5105c1f4cefd7cc527145126.pdf
https://repositoriouba.sisbi.uba.ar/gsdl/cgi-bin/library.cgi?a=d&c=aigmaster&d=18432_oai
Aporte de:
id I28-R145-18432_oai
record_format dspace
spelling I28-R145-18432_oai2024-12-02 Ridolfi, Pablo En la presente memoria se aborda el desarrollo de una capa de portabilidad de software que permite ejecutar los principales módulos del Firmware CIAA sobre una plataforma de hardware basada en el procesador LEON3. Este último es un procesador embebible en dispositivos de lógica programable FPGA que es frecuentemente utilizado en aplicaciones de tipo aeroespacial asociado a dispositivos tolerantes a radiación. El desarrollo del trabajo abarcó el estudio de la arquitectura de procesadores SPARC a la que pertenece el procesador LEON3, el análisis de la implementación del estándar OSEK y de la capa POSIX utilizados en el Firmware CIAA, el diseño de las estrategias de reemplazo del contexto de tareas y de administración de las interrupciones del sistema, la implementación en código de estas estrategias en la capa de portabilidad, su puesta en marcha utilizando dos modelos de sistemas basados en el procesador LEON3 (uno físico en FPGA y otro simulado), y la validación del sistema utilizando una batería de ensayos estandarizados que forma parte del Firmware CIAA. Puga, Gerardo L. 2016 Grado obtenido: Especialista en sistemas embebidos Disciplina: Especialización en sistemas embebidos Fil: Puga, Gerardo L. Universidad de Buenos Aires. Facultad de Ingeniería; Argentina. application/pdf https://bibliotecadigital.fi.uba.ar/items/show/18432 https://bibliotecadigital.fi.uba.ar/files/original/fbd9b01e5105c1f4cefd7cc527145126.pdf spa Universidad de Buenos Aires. Facultad de Ingeniería info:eu-repo/semantics/openAccess http://creativecommons.org/licenses/by/2.5/ar/ DISEÑO DE SOFTWARE HARDWARE INGENIERIA AEROESPACIAL PROCESADORES PROTECCIONES CONTRA LAS RADIACIONES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3 info:eu-repo/semantics/masterThesis info:ar-repo/semantics/tesis de maestría info:eu-repo/semantics/acceptedVersion https://repositoriouba.sisbi.uba.ar/gsdl/cgi-bin/library.cgi?a=d&c=aigmaster&d=18432_oai
institution Universidad de Buenos Aires
institution_str I-28
repository_str R-145
collection Repositorio Digital de la Universidad de Buenos Aires (UBA)
language Español
orig_language_str_mv spa
topic En la presente memoria se aborda el desarrollo de una capa de portabilidad de software que permite ejecutar los principales módulos del Firmware CIAA sobre una plataforma de hardware basada en el procesador LEON3. Este último es un procesador embebible en dispositivos de lógica programable FPGA que es frecuentemente utilizado en aplicaciones de tipo aeroespacial asociado a dispositivos tolerantes a radiación. El desarrollo del trabajo abarcó el estudio de la arquitectura de procesadores SPARC a la que pertenece el procesador LEON3, el análisis de la implementación del estándar OSEK y de la capa POSIX utilizados en el Firmware CIAA, el diseño de las estrategias de reemplazo del contexto de tareas y de administración de las interrupciones del sistema, la implementación en código de estas estrategias en la capa de portabilidad, su puesta en marcha utilizando dos modelos de sistemas basados en el procesador LEON3 (uno físico en FPGA y otro simulado), y la validación del sistema utilizando una batería de ensayos estandarizados que forma parte del Firmware CIAA.
DISEÑO DE SOFTWARE
HARDWARE
INGENIERIA AEROESPACIAL
PROCESADORES
PROTECCIONES CONTRA LAS RADIACIONES
spellingShingle En la presente memoria se aborda el desarrollo de una capa de portabilidad de software que permite ejecutar los principales módulos del Firmware CIAA sobre una plataforma de hardware basada en el procesador LEON3. Este último es un procesador embebible en dispositivos de lógica programable FPGA que es frecuentemente utilizado en aplicaciones de tipo aeroespacial asociado a dispositivos tolerantes a radiación. El desarrollo del trabajo abarcó el estudio de la arquitectura de procesadores SPARC a la que pertenece el procesador LEON3, el análisis de la implementación del estándar OSEK y de la capa POSIX utilizados en el Firmware CIAA, el diseño de las estrategias de reemplazo del contexto de tareas y de administración de las interrupciones del sistema, la implementación en código de estas estrategias en la capa de portabilidad, su puesta en marcha utilizando dos modelos de sistemas basados en el procesador LEON3 (uno físico en FPGA y otro simulado), y la validación del sistema utilizando una batería de ensayos estandarizados que forma parte del Firmware CIAA.
DISEÑO DE SOFTWARE
HARDWARE
INGENIERIA AEROESPACIAL
PROCESADORES
PROTECCIONES CONTRA LAS RADIACIONES
Puga, Gerardo L.
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
topic_facet En la presente memoria se aborda el desarrollo de una capa de portabilidad de software que permite ejecutar los principales módulos del Firmware CIAA sobre una plataforma de hardware basada en el procesador LEON3. Este último es un procesador embebible en dispositivos de lógica programable FPGA que es frecuentemente utilizado en aplicaciones de tipo aeroespacial asociado a dispositivos tolerantes a radiación. El desarrollo del trabajo abarcó el estudio de la arquitectura de procesadores SPARC a la que pertenece el procesador LEON3, el análisis de la implementación del estándar OSEK y de la capa POSIX utilizados en el Firmware CIAA, el diseño de las estrategias de reemplazo del contexto de tareas y de administración de las interrupciones del sistema, la implementación en código de estas estrategias en la capa de portabilidad, su puesta en marcha utilizando dos modelos de sistemas basados en el procesador LEON3 (uno físico en FPGA y otro simulado), y la validación del sistema utilizando una batería de ensayos estandarizados que forma parte del Firmware CIAA.
DISEÑO DE SOFTWARE
HARDWARE
INGENIERIA AEROESPACIAL
PROCESADORES
PROTECCIONES CONTRA LAS RADIACIONES
description Grado obtenido: Especialista en sistemas embebidos
author2 Ridolfi, Pablo
author_facet Ridolfi, Pablo
Puga, Gerardo L.
format Tesis de maestría
Tesis de maestría
acceptedVersion
author Puga, Gerardo L.
author_sort Puga, Gerardo L.
title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
title_short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
title_full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
title_fullStr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
title_full_unstemmed Desarrollo de capa de compatibilidad del firmware CIAA para procesadores LEON3
title_sort desarrollo de capa de compatibilidad del firmware ciaa para procesadores leon3
publisher Universidad de Buenos Aires. Facultad de Ingeniería
publishDate 2016
url https://bibliotecadigital.fi.uba.ar/items/show/18432
https://bibliotecadigital.fi.uba.ar/files/original/fbd9b01e5105c1f4cefd7cc527145126.pdf
https://repositoriouba.sisbi.uba.ar/gsdl/cgi-bin/library.cgi?a=d&c=aigmaster&d=18432_oai
work_keys_str_mv AT pugagerardol desarrollodecapadecompatibilidaddelfirmwareciaaparaprocesadoresleon3
_version_ 1824357050961887232